A Muslim never forgets their duties to Allah, this short video shows how loyal a slave is to his Master Allah SWT. Even though he's been hospitalised and can barely move a limb, he's using his arms and his mouth to call Allah. Subhanaallah! Yet some of us having good health and perfectly fit to pray neglect Salaah. Pray before your Jannazah is prayed for you.

"Verily, I am Allah. There is no god but I: So serve only Me (only), and establish regular prayer for My remembrance". {Surah Taha: 14}

Making Salaah and ibaadat a habit is something that not only will help you in the Akhirah but also when your not able to help yourself. Memorising short ayats from the Quran and reciting them when your travelling, or sitting, whatever you do during the day praising Allah a few times a day increases your good deeds.
